Sulfur has several direct uses:
- Grubfruit Plants consume 10 kg per cycle of Sulfur as fertilizer.
- Sweetles eat 20 kg per cycle of Sulfur.

- Because of its softness and low melting point, it can be used to build natural tiles for Pip ranches.
